Set in the aftermath of Satan's banishment, the story explores his quest for revenge against God by targeting humanity. Rallying his followers, Satan devises a plan to corrupt Adam and Eve in the idyllic Garden of Eden, where they initially enjoy a blissful life. As he seduces them into disobedience, their paradise begins to unravel. The couple remains oblivious to their impending downfall until God confronts them, leading to their desperate plea for forgiveness. This tale delves into themes of temptation, free will, and the consequences of choice.
